It will be interesting to see if the K League can produce a homegrown goal scorer for the third year in a row.

Currently, the most prolific goal scorers in the K League 1 are Lee In-gyu (Ulsan) and Na Sang-ho (Seoul). They are tied for the league lead with 11 goals apiece.

At the beginning of the season, Na Sang-ho was on a goal-scoring tear and took the lead. However, after a two-month hiatus, Lee In-jong-kyu surged to the top of the leaderboard, and Na Sang-ho rejoined him with a multi-goal performance in a home match against Suwon FC on December 12.

In the past, foreign strikers have dominated the top scoring positions in the K League. It was the fourth consecutive year that a foreigner was the top scorer after Chung Joguk (then of Gwangju) won the title in 2016.

Then, Cho Kyu-sung (Meatwillan) became the first Korean to win the top scorer title in five years in the 2020 season, and then last season, Cho Kyu-sung (Incheon Mugosa) took over the top scorer title after the previous top scorer abruptly moved to Bissell Kobe (Japan).

Two homegrown strikers continue to lead the scoring race this season. However, they are closely followed by Bako (Ulsan – 10 goals) and Ras (Suwon FC – 8 goals), so the competition between natives and foreigners will be fierce until the end of the season.

Na Sang-ho, who became the joint top scorer with a multi-goal performance against Suwon FC last season, made no secret of his desire to be the top scorer. In particular, he expressed his desire to compete with Lee In-gyu to the end.

Min and Sang-ho Na, who are tied for the top scoring honors, will face off again this weekend.

Inhabigyu will be on the hunt for a goal against bottom-placed Suwon Samseong on the 15th, while Na Sang-ho will be looking for his 12th goal against Gangwon in Gangneung on the same day.

It will be interesting to see if the Koreans can overcome the stiff competition from foreign players to become the top scorers once again this season.
